What Is Orchestration
Orchestration refers to the automated coordination and management of multiple systems, tasks, and workflows. It ensures that different components interact in the right order, at the right time, and in the right way.
Instead of managing each process manually, orchestration connects everything into a unified flow.
For example:
- An AI system collects data
- Another system processes that data
- A third system makes decisions
- A fourth system executes actions
Orchestration ensures all these steps happen seamlessly without delays or conflicts.

Orchestration vs Automation
Many people confuse orchestration with automation, but they are different.
- Automation focuses on individual tasks
- Orchestration manages multiple automated tasks as a complete process
Think of automation as individual instruments and orchestration as the conductor of an orchestra. Both are important, but orchestration ensures everything works together.
Key Components of Orchestration
To implement orchestration effectively, organizations need:
Workflow Design
Clear workflows define how tasks should be executed and connected.
Integration
Systems must be connected through APIs and data pipelines.
Monitoring
Continuous monitoring ensures that workflows run smoothly and issues are detected early.
Error Handling
Orchestration systems must handle failures and recover automatically.
